Get the patch 1.032 : 2 quicksave slots - and more if you change this. Patch link, click here, please

Save often and on different saves

If you can't click it drag&drop it into your inventory (my rule <img src="/ubbthreads/images/graemlins/winkwink.gif" alt="" />)

Brighten up your gamma - options menu - video - gamma, this helps in dungeons to find levers

Get the alchemy skill as soon as possible, lvl 1 allows you to mix red + blue potions = white (restoration), they're far more effective.
Alchemy spoiler, click here, please

Look for keys before using lockpicks (chests, doors), but in the dungeons = have a lookout for levers, they're shaped like a demon's head


[Linked Image]

Kill Jake twice

Don't refuse George his Drudanae plant and ASK Lanilor first before taking

Don't use the healing gem at once - you can heal both soldiers

Don't annoy Otho (kill pigs, break banner, steal Lanilor's plant)

Don't give Smiruk the Orc an unidentified axe, he takes all and you can have a hanging cutscene afterwards - you'll see why <img src="/ubbthreads/images/graemlins/winkwink.gif" alt="" />

Keep your Zombie helper away from the orcs, they're enemies - if you teleport yourself to the groundlvl, he will die - so try to shut him away in the dungeon before going/teleporting up

Solve all quests on ground lvl first, then enter the dungeons, enemies may be hard.

Dungeon
Get the tellie pyramids as soon as possible, by teleporting yourself to the 2nd, fight the skellies there, drag&drop tellie into your inventory and then teleport yourself back to where the other one is. Carry one tellie with you, place the other one in the abandoned house, if you're encumbered or bad in health, drop this tellie and teleport yourself back up = sleep, sell, identify or drop loot - teleport yourself back, pick your tellie up and proceed.

If you enter small sub-dungeons, SAVE first, those enemies in there are harder


In the last lvl, look at screenshot spoiler, touching ONE specific lever sets cutscene going - so loot everything first there. If the boss fight comes and you're weak: make a run for the exit, Mardaneus will rscue you with an energy arc - though you loose XP points for killing then

Mana: sleep or potions, no other way and food isn't practicable, a mage does not eat much = the best are restoration potions, did you notice the alchemy thread I added in the post above?

I'll tell you how I did it, ok?
Per lvl-up: 2 pts in int. the rest on the others = had far over 100
agility? depends on the weapon = for bows pretty high
armour depends on strength 60-70 at least

Look for items/weapons/armour boosting up stats and giving spells, you'll find them <img src="/ubbthreads/images/graemlins/winkwink.gif" alt="" />.
Kiya

Learn the enchant weapon skill = you can boost up stats via charms, do you know how? Enchanting weapons, warrior skill, click here
There are no class restrictions, just change your path in the abilities book, by clicking on the < > buttons, then choose the skill you wish and confirm.

and when you finish aleroth, take a good run AROUND Aleroth, the orcs you'll find there should be relatively easy but very good for exp. points.

Also try to get level 35 strength asap, this will enable you to start carrying better weapons with (a lot) more damage (for your level). It will make things so much easier, you can rebalance afterwards in other stats.

Oh and yes, try chicken meat, gives you mana, and normal meat from the rabbits hopping around, restore vitality (full life bar restoration in the beginning)
Get the teleport asap.You will get one of two, once you opened the gate to the catacombs. Go fetch the other teleport first by teleporting yourself to the other missing teleport. Be warned of multiple enemies upon arrival. Put one teleport near your bed, and one in your stash. When u run out of life or mana zap yourself to your bed to take a nap (this will give you full life/mana.
Your room is found in a basement of one of the houses in Aleroth (the house where you start the game). Feel free to decorate your room with plants, pots and especially gems; it's gives a beautifull glow and is a lot of fun to do.

Oh and yes, the zombie that helps you in the catacombs, get rid of it asap (by surfacing back in the village)
Why ? the enemies it kills do not add to Your Experience! which is pretty important when you start. Each Kill Matters!
